In loving memory of

Cathy Michels
June 26, 1964 - December 28, 2011

Cathy Michels, of Bryant, died Wednesday, December 28, 2011 at Langlade Hospital under the care of her family and LeRoyer Hospice. She was 47 years old. She was born on June 26, 1964 in Antigo, a daughter of Marian (Walters) Koss and the late Vernon Koss. She married Keith Michels on May 16, 1992 at St. Wencel Catholic Church in Neva. He survives.

She was a graduate of Antigo High School in 1982 and received an associates degree in accounting from North Central Technical College Antigo.

She worked at Spurgeons in Antigo for eleven years. For the past 20 she was employed in Antigo at Bank One which became Chase Bank.

Mrs. Michels volunteered as a leader for the Mayflower 4-H Club, and was a member of the Junior Women's club. As a member of St. Wencel Catholic Church she served as the parish bookkeeper, on the parish council and taught religious education.

Survivors including her husband and mother are a daughter Abby Michels, at home; a sister Jeanne Koss, Kenosha; two brothers Tony Koss and special friend Cindy Kuhls of Deerbrook, Pete (Denice) Koss, Green Bay and their children Matthew and Morgan Koss.

She is also survived by her husbands family: father and mother-in-law Julius and Lorraine Michels; a sister-in-law Cheryl Meyer; five brothers-in-law Ronald Michels and special friend Tina Moreno, Dennis, Jerome, and Kenneth Michels and Kevin (Michelle) Michels.

A funeral Mass will be held on Saturday at 10:30 a.m. at St. Wencel Catholic Church with Rev. Jeremiah Worman officiating. Burial will take place in the parish cemetery. Visitation will be 3-8 p.m. on Friday at the Bradley Funeral Home and 9-10 a.m. on Saturday at the funeral home. A parish wake service will be held at 4:30 p.m. Friday at the funeral home.
